[ QUOTE ]
1150 pot, 768 dollars to call where we are behind? There is no "pot odds" its like 1.5 to flip for 800 we dont even have invested where we are behind like 8% all the times and about 0.04% we are crushed? Maybe if he had about 15x bb this would be a call.

[/ QUOTE ]

You're kidding, right?


http://twodimes.net/h/?z=3149
pokenum -h qs qd - ah kc
Holdem Hi: 1712304 enumerated boards
cards win %win lose %lose tie %tie EV
Qs Qd 975909 56.99 730541 42.66 5854 0.34 0.572
Kc Ah 730541 42.66 975909 56.99 5854 0.34 0.428

$1946 x .428= 832.88 Call=+$74.88

http://twodimes.net/h/?z=51993
pokenum -h kd kh - ah kc
Holdem Hi: 1712304 enumerated boards
cards win %win lose %lose tie %tie EV
Kd Kh 1187967 69.38 509318 29.74 15019 0.88 0.698
Kc Ah 509318 29.74 1187967 69.38 15019 0.88 0.302

1946 x.302= 587.69 Call is -$180.30, also much less likely. I did overestimate the equity in pot vs KK tho, but I still have no problem with this. He COULD possibly even be ahead ( VERY unlikely) or tied (possible).

Also, AK is light-years better than AQ.
